
Your flights are booked, your itinerary is set, your luggage is filled to the brim with your ideal outfits—all that’s left to pack are your travel makeup essentials for a fun holiday ahead. Whether you’re adhering to TSA guidelines or just want to pack lightly, most of us will not be taking our complete makeup collection along for the ride—making the unavoidable task of paring down your beauty stash an important one.
A beauty tip? Visualize the entire routine you’ll practice once you land from start to finish. You’ll want at least one complexion product to even skin tone and veil imperfections, along with multitasking pigments to bring warmth and subtle color to the face—plus, whatever you use to awaken your gaze, like eyeliner or mascara. And if your plans call for glam, eyeshadows and lipsticks are worthwhile additions, too. Below, I’ve created the ultimate makeup packing guide for your summer holiday and beyond.
Trusted Organizers
First things first, determine what travel makeup organizers work best for you. Maybe you already own the best toiletry bag that can fit both your skin-care and makeup necessities, or perhaps you’d prefer to store them separately. A water-resistant case has spacious compartments, transparent pockets, and even a detachable wet pouch—perfect to secure in your carry-on. Otherwise, consider a zippered pouch, which is wide enough to fit all your cosmetics, yet still compact to pop in your purse or personal item for easy access.
Skin Prep
Experts routinely emphasize the importance of skin prep for glowing skin with or without makeup. My takeaway? Rely on nourishing formulas and face primers to prep your base. First reach for an exceptionally hydrating and soothing serum , then a cream to restore moisture and ready skin for makeup.
Flawless Complexion
Selecting your vacation complexion products is arguably the hardest part, with so many different types of foundations and tints to choose from—not to mention your own skin color potentially changing after spending time in the sun. You can't go wrong with Rare Beauty’s tinted moisturizer that even boasts sun protection plus soothing agents like lotus, gardenia, and white water lily, whereas someone after a more skin-like finish will appreciate the ever-evolving world of complexion balms.
